Withdrawal
PERFORMANCE ORDER | 1. Disconnect a hose and crankcase ventilation hose. | 2. Remove the water pump pulley and the crankshaft pulley. | 3. Remove the cover of a gear belt. | 4. Loosen the bolt of the pulley mechanism of a tension of a gear belt, pull the pulley to the side and secure it in this position. | 5. Remove a gear belt from a camshaft pulley. | 6. Unscrew the bolts and remove the motor from the center cover. | 7. Remove the ignition coils. | 8. Remove the bolts and remove the cylinder head cover. | | 9. Remove the bolt and remove the camshaft pulley. | 10. Remove the camshaft and timing belt. | 11. Remove camshaft. | 12. Remove the hydraulic jacks of backlashes of valves. |

Checking (engine A5D) PERFORMANCE ORDER | 1. Place the first and last cervical camshaft on V-shaped blocks. | 2. Place the measuring head dial indicator to the middle neck bearing of the camshaft and install the indicator scale to 0. | | 3. Turn the camshaft and measure its palpation. Maximum permissible camshaft runout: 0.03 mm | 4. Check the camshaft to the absence of uneven wear, cracks or damage. | | 5. In the two points, measure the height of each cam camshaft. The height of the cams of the intake and exhaust camshafts: Rated - 42.870 mm The minimum allowable - 42,868 mm | | 6. In the two perpendicular directions, and the two planes, measure the diameter of the neck of each camshaft. Nominal Diameter: 33,961-34,000 mm The minimum allowable diameter: 26.910 mm Maximum allowable roundness: 0.03 mm | | 7. If the wear of cams and cam bearing journals exceeds the limit, replace the camshaft. | 8. Measure the clearance in the bearings of camshafts in remote hydraulic valve compensators. | 9. Clean the grease from the neck bearing camshaft bearings in the cover and the camshaft bearings into the cylinder head. | 10. Install the camshafts on the cylinder head. | 11. In order to measure the clearance using a plastic calibrated round bar Plastigauge. Plastigauge rod is compressed between the bearing and the neck of the camshaft. After removing the camshaft bearing cap deformed plastic rod Plastigauge measured by a special pattern, which is available in the kit. Cut pieces of plastic rod and place them on the neck of a camshaft. | 12. After the installation of plastic rods do not turn the camshafts. | | 13. Install the camshaft cover. | 14. Install the cover bolts camshaft and tighten them in stages. The inhaling moment: 11,2-14,2 N ??? m | 15. Remove the cover bolts camshaft. | 16. Remove the camshaft. | | 17. By measuring the pattern width of the deformed plastic core, identify gaps in the camshaft bearings. Nominal backlash: 0,035-0,081 mm Maximum permissible backlash: 0,15 mm | 18. If the backlash exceeds the limit, replace the cylinder head. | 19. Install the camshafts. | 20. Establish a measuring tip of a dial indicator on the end of the camshaft. | 21. Move a camshaft along the axis of the way to one side. | 22. Establish an arrow of a dial indicator to 0. | 23. Move a camshaft along the axis of the way to the other side. | | 24. Review the evidence on the dial gauge, which shows the amount of axial play of the camshaft. Nominal axial clearance: 0,067-0,137 mm Maximum permissible backlash: 0.147 mm |

Checking (engine A3E) PERFORMANCE ORDER | 1. Place the first and last cervical camshaft on V-shaped blocks. | 2. Place the measuring head dial indicator to the middle neck bearing of the camshaft and install the indicator scale to 0. | | 3. Turn the camshaft and measure its palpation. Maximum permissible camshaft runout: 0.03 mm | 4. Check the camshaft to the absence of uneven wear, cracks or damage. | | 5. In the two points, measure the height of each cam camshaft. The height of the cams of the inlet camshaft: Rated - 36.3422 mm The minimum allowable - 36.3402 mm Height cams exhaust camshaft: Rated - 36.0752 mm The minimum allowable - 36.0732 mm | | 6. In the two perpendicular directions, and the two planes, measure the diameter of each camshaft necks. 1 and 3 cervical camshaft: 43,440-43,460 mm 2 neck camshaft: 43,430-43,455 mm |
